| Voltage is an important indicator of the power quality. Reactive power compensation and reactive power balance are fundamental conditions to guarantee voltage quality for power system, Effective control and reasonable reactive power compensation, can not only ensure the power quality, but also improve the stability and safety of power system, reduce electric energy loss, enhance the equipments transmission capacity and economic efficiency for power system.The article analyzes the purpose and significance of reactive power optimization, this article introduces the research status of reactive voltage optimization control, and briefly analyzes the advantages and disadvantages of various control systems. At the same time introduces the commonly used in reactive power optimization problem of several intelligent optimization algorithms, On the basis of the in-depth study of the Changzhou power network reactive power optimization control problems.Changzhou power network still exist some inadequacy in reactive power optimization control, including substation capacitors within the unit capacity is too big, reactive power compensation is not flexible, easy to cause excessive reactive compensation or inadequate; With the continuous development of power network, power load is increased, part of the substation reactive power compensation capacity is insufficient; The power network operation mode is changeful, strategy is not corresponding to the reactive power optimization control system, or to perform is limited; Reactive power optimization control system control module, led to some special connection mode, the system cannot correspond. Aiming at the existing problem of Changzhou power network reactive power optimization control, this paper puts forward the corresponding solutions, To reasonable grouping of capacitor, the capacitor has a capacity of refining a few copies of controlled respectively; Increase the capacitor Banks, increase the capacitance of the substation; Improved control strategy of reactive power optimization system, refinement system control parameters; Increase the system control module, make its can adapt to more special connection mode.Based on the reactive power optimization proposed improvement scheme, this article was carried out example analysis, validate the rationality of the proposed solutions. Compare the voltage qualified rate and the percent of pass on electricity rate before and after, the result shows clear with the improved scheme have a more obvious increase. |
